Channels, hours and first-response times

Channels, hours and first-response times — customer service in the UK

The comparison table above lists the current contact windows for each operator, so this section deals with the market pattern rather than repeating those rows. Four channels dominate in the UK market:

Live chat
the default channel at almost every modern operator, typically staffed around the clock at the larger brands. First response is usually measured in seconds to a few minutes; the catch is that the first responder is often a bot or a generalist agent working from scripts.
Email or ticket form
the channel through which anything involving documents, account history or formal complaints should run, because it creates a written record. First replies commonly arrive within 4 to 48 hours; anything beyond three working days is a warning sign.
Telephone
increasingly rare. The major UK high-street brands retain phone lines; most newer entrants do not, and many of those which do restrict hours to roughly 08:00–22:00 UK time.
Social media and messaging apps
some operators monitor X or WhatsApp. Useful for nudging a stalled ticket, but never suitable for sharing account details, since the channel is not secured to your account.
ChannelTypical first responseBest used forRecord kept?
Live chatSeconds to 5 minutesQuick status checks, bonus activation questionsUsually transcript on request
Email / ticket4–48 hoursVerification, withdrawals, formal complaintsYes — full written trail
TelephoneQueue of 2–20 minutes where offeredUrgent account security issuesRarely, unless you take notes
Social / messaging1–12 hours where monitoredNudging a stalled ticket, never account detailsPublic — treat accordingly

Two conditions move any of these figures. First, complexity: a question about when your free spins reset is answered in one exchange, while a withdrawal query touching verification can only be escalated upwards, adding days. Second, volume: evenings, weekends and the days around major sporting fixtures and promotional launches are the busiest windows, and a Sunday-night ticket may sit behind hundreds of others until Monday morning. When a slot tournament ends or a seasonal promotion finishes, expect queues on the bonus-related queue specifically. The issues players raise most often

Across the market, the volume of contacts is heavily concentrated in a handful of categories. Understanding which category your issue falls into tells you who can actually solve it and how long a realistic resolution looks like.

Issue typeTypical resolution pathRealistic timescale
Bonus not credited after a qualifying depositFirst-line agent, sometimes with a manual creditMinutes to 24 hours
Withdrawal pending longer than the advertised windowPayments team, often after a verification check1–5 working days
Documents rejected or repeatedly re-requestedVerification (KYC) team2–10 working days if contested
Game malfunction or voided roundEscalated to the game provider3–14 working days
Account restriction or closed account with balanceSenior or compliance team; possibly ADRWeeks, not days

The pattern is consistent: the more a query touches compliance rather than the product, the slower and more procedural it becomes. A missing batch of spins or a delayed activation of a welcome bonus sits with general agents and is usually fixed with a manual credit the same day. A withdrawal held at 48 hours past the advertised pending window almost always means the payments queue has intersected with a random or triggered verification check, and no chat agent can overrule that — only the compliance team can release funds. The most serious category, a restricted or closed account holding a balance, sits almost entirely outside the influence of first-line staff, which is why the escalation path later on this page matters. Verification handled as a support process

Verification — usually called KYC, know-your-customer — is the single biggest source of friction between players and operators, and it is fundamentally a support process as much as a compliance one. Documents you will be asked for

The standard set is predictable across the market. Expect to be asked for, in rough order of likelihood:

  1. Photo identification — a passport or photocard driving licence, all four corners visible, no glare, and not a screenshot of a saved image that has been compressed by a messaging app.
  2. Proof of address — a bank statement or utility bill dated within the last three months, showing your name and the registered address exactly.
  3. Proof of payment method — a photo of the card used for deposits with the middle digits covered, or a wallet screenshot showing your name and recent transactions.
  4. Source-of-funds evidence — only at larger amounts or flagged patterns: payslips, a letter from an employer, or evidence of the origin of a large win or transfer.

The thresholds that trigger requests vary. Many operators verify identity before the first withdrawal regardless of amount; others apply a random check earlier in the account's life. As a general market pattern, deposits or withdrawals beginning to move in the £2,000–£5,000 range bring requests forward, and anything above roughly £10,000 almost always attracts source-of-funds questions. None of this is optional or adversarial — it is a regulatory norm, and treating it as a routine administrative step rather than an obstacle is the fastest route through. Typical timings and what slows them down

A clean first submission is usually cleared within 24 to 72 hours; automated document checks at larger operators can return a verdict in under an hour for straightforward passports. The common causes of multi-week delays are almost all avoidable: a document older than three months, a name mismatch between the account and the ID (a middle name present on one and absent on the other), a cropped or glare-obscured photograph, a screenshot instead of a PDF or original photo, and deposits made from a payment method not registered in the player's own name. Each of these produces a rejection, and each rejection adds another full review cycle — often another one to three working days — before a human looks at the file again. When checks stall

If a verification file has sat without movement for more than five working days, ask for three things explicitly in writing: the current status of the file, the name of the department holding it, and an expected completion date. Written replies create accountability, and a dated ticket number is what you will need if the matter later needs escalating. Do not submit duplicate document sets through multiple channels — duplicates frequently reset the queue position rather than accelerate it. Payments queries and withdrawal tracking

Withdrawal questions deserve their own treatment because they combine two clocks: the operator's internal pending period and the payment network's own processing time. A typical non-card sequence looks like this — the withdrawal is requested and sits in a pending window of 0 to 48 hours depending on the operator (some process instantly, many hold for 24 hours to allow reversal), then the payment is released, and then the receiving network takes over: e-wallets commonly complete within a few hours of release, cards within one to three working days, and bank transfers within three to five. When a player says a payout is "slow", it is worth establishing which of the three stages is actually causing the delay, because the remedy differs completely at each stage — and no amount of chatting can compress the middle stage if the operator's terms state a 48-hour pending window.

One further note: if a pending period is being extended repeatedly without a stated reason, request the specific clause of the terms being applied. Legitimate holds almost always cite either an active verification check or a security review of the transaction pattern, and you are entitled to know which applies. Writing a ticket that gets a real answer

customer service in the UK — Writing a ticket that gets a real answer

The difference between a query that is closed in one exchange and one that bounces through five template replies is usually the structure of the first message. Agents handling high volumes triage fast, and a message that lets them triage instantly is a message that gets routed to the right team first time. An effective ticket contains, in this order:

Subject line with the category and dates
for example, "Withdrawal #12345 pending beyond stated 24h window, requested 14 January".
Account identifier
username or registered email, stated once, clearly.
One-sentence summary of the problem
the outcome you believe is owed, not the story of the evening it went wrong.
The exact figures
amounts, dates, timestamps, transaction references, bonus codes used.
What you have already tried
so the agent does not restart the standard script.
The specific question or remedy requested
"please confirm the release date" or "please credit the advertised offer".

Equally important is what to leave out. Screenshots are welcome, but attach the two or three that show the transaction, not twenty. Caps lock, accusations and paragraphs of history slow the triage down, because an agent who feels attacked will route the ticket to a supervisor rather than solve it. And keep everything in one ticket: splitting a problem across chat, email and social media creates three partial records, none of which contains the full picture. When the first reply is a template: the escalation path

Template replies are not automatically evasive — a first response that restates the terms is often just the cheapest way to filter out queries the terms already answer. But if the reply plainly does not address your specific facts, escalation is appropriate, and it follows a fairly standard ladder across the industry. Second contact and supervisor request

Reply to the same ticket — do not open a new one — and ask two things explicitly: that the response address each numbered point from your original message in turn, and that the ticket be escalated to a supervisor or the relevant specialist team if that is not possible. State a reasonable deadline, typically five working days. Most operators have internal escalation targets, and a written request citing an unanswered, dated ticket moves your file up the queue far more reliably than a new complaint in chat. This is also the stage at which newer operations sometimes reveal their limits: a site whose escalation consists solely of the same chat queue has, in effect, no escalation path, which is itself information — a point developed in the next section but one. Formal complaint through the operator

If the supervisor round does not resolve matters, submit a formal complaint in writing, using that word explicitly. Operators are required to run a complaints procedure, and the formal route obliges them to issue a final response — usually within eight weeks at UK-licensed firms, and within the period stated in their own terms elsewhere. The final response letter matters enormously, because it is the document you take forward to external review. Keep every stage: initial ticket, replies, dates, reference numbers. ADR and the licensing authority

At a UKGC-licensed operator, the final response can be taken to an independent Alternative Dispute Resolution service free of charge, and the operator is bound by the outcome. The major high-street brands in the comparison table — the Bet365, William Hill, Ladbrokes and Coral category of household names — all operate within this framework, which is the single most meaningful structural difference between them and overseas-licensed newcomers. At a site licensed abroad, the path runs through the operator's own complaints procedure and then to the regulator that issued its licence, where response quality varies considerably by jurisdiction. Before depositing anywhere, it is worth knowing in advance which of these two worlds your chosen site occupies, because that determines your options precisely at the moment when you have the least leverage. Larger amounts and new accounts

Larger amounts and new accounts: customer service guide for players in the UK

Two variables change the support equation materially. The first is stake size. A £20 withdrawal query is handled by the standard queue; a £5,000 withdrawal almost always triggers additional review, and at the higher end a source-of-funds conversation is likely even if your account has been verified for months. None of this is a reason to expect difficulty — players with a consistent, documented history pass these reviews routinely — but it does mean the timescales on this page should be read as applying to the ordinary case, with the larger amounts adding days to weeks at the compliance stage rather than hours. The second variable is account age. A brand-new account combining a large first deposit with an immediately requested withdrawal is the single most-reviewed pattern in the industry, and support teams are trained to scrutinise it. If you are comparing options and expect to move substantial sums, check before signing up whether identity verification is required at registration or only at first withdrawal — being verified before depositing removes the most common source of first-payout friction entirely. Support and safer gambling tools

A support team is also the channel through which the most important controls on any account are exercised. Deposit limits, session reminders, cool-off periods and self-exclusion should all be settable from the account settings area, but any agent can apply them on request — and a good operator will do so immediately, without attempts to talk the player out of it. The manner in which a site handles that request is perhaps the clearest single indicator of its character: delays, upselling or "are you sure?" loops around a self-exclusion request are grounds to withdraw your custom. At UKGC-licensed firms, participation in GamStop is mandatory, and site-level exclusion sits on top of it. If gambling is causing harm, GamCare's National Gambling Helpline offers free, confidential support, and no support agent on any site is a substitute for that. Setting a deposit limit at the moment you open an account, rather than after the first losing session, is the single most effective habit on this entire page.

Mistakes that delay a resolution

Most of the delay in a support case is self-inflicted in small, avoidable ways. The recurring ones:

  1. Opening a new ticket for every follow-up instead of replying to the existing one, which fragments the record and resets queue position.
  2. Arguing the general principle ("your site is a scam") instead of the specific facts ("transaction #12345 has been pending 96 hours against a stated 24").
  3. Submitting documents as compressed screenshots through chat rather than full-resolution files through the ticket system.
  4. Demanding instant escalation on a query that is simply inside its normal processing window — a 30-hour withdrawal against a 48-hour advertised pending period is not yet a complaint.
  5. Threatening chargebacks in writing, which converts a payments query into a security review and almost always freezes the account until the review ends.

Avoid these five and even a mediocre support operation can usually be brought to a conclusion within its stated timescales.
